Supervisor: Preschool Director, Volunteer Coordinator
Location: YWCA A Special Place Preschool
Purpose: To work on-site with children attending the YWCA "A Special Place" Therapeutic Preschool to promote social-emotional skills and model positive behavior. Preschool Assistants work with children in small groups or individually and provide support to teachers. This provides volunteers the opportunity to work with children in challenging situations and give them a positive environment to grow.
Duties:
- Support staff during planned activities
- Promote and enhance development through positive relationships
- Participate in school chores and maintain the learning environment
- Consult staff as needed
- General clerical duties including but not limited to maintaining and organizing filing systems, mailing letters, restocking office supplies
- Creating Flyers and Newsletters to update families and promote programs
- Help prepare and serve breakfast, lunch, and snacks as needed
- Assist with some program events when necessary
- Desire to work with children in a nurturing and supportive manner
- Interest in learning about social work and early childhood education
- Sensitivity and desire to work with children in crisis while maintaining boundaries
- Proficiency in Spanish preferred but not required
- A minimum of one 3-hour shift weekly for a minimum of 3 months, not to exceed 16 hours each week.
